windows与linux命令区别大不

worktile 其他 19

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Windows和Linux是两种常见的操作系统,它们在命令行接口方面有一些区别。下面将列举一些主要的区别。

    1. 命令语法:Windows命令行采用的是命令行解释器cmd.exe,而Linux采用的则是shell(如bash)。
    – Windows命令行采用的是基于DOS的命令语法,命令通常是单词或缩写的组合。
    – Linux命令行采用的是类似于自然语言的命令语法,命令通常是单词的组合。

    2. 路径表示:Windows使用反斜杠\来表示路径,例如C:\Program Files\。
    – Linux使用斜杠/来表示路径,例如/usr/bin/。

    3. 命令名称:一些常见的命令在Windows和Linux中的名称不一样。
    – 在Windows中,文件夹相关的命令是dir、cd等,而在Linux中是ls、cd等。
    – 在Windows中,显示IP配置的命令是ipconfig,而在Linux中是ifconfig。

    4. 文件系统:Windows使用FAT和NTFS文件系统,而Linux使用诸如ext4等文件系统。因此,在命令行中处理文件的一些命令在两个系统上可能有一些不同。

    5. 文件路径区分大小写:在Windows中,文件路径不区分大小写,而在Linux中是区分大小写的。

    6. 文件权限管理:在Linux中,文件和目录有属主、属组和其他用户的权限管理,而在Windows中,文件和目录的权限管理相对简单。

    7. 编程环境:Linux系统提供了更多的编程开发工具,如gcc编译器等,而Windows系统则更适合于图形界面应用程序的开发。

    综上所述,Windows和Linux的命令行接口存在一些区别,包括命令语法、路径表示、命令名称、文件系统、文件路径区分大小写、文件权限管理和编程环境等方面。熟悉这些区别有助于在两个系统中更有效地使用命令行。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Windows和Linux是两个最常见的操作系统,它们在命令行操作方面有一些区别。

    1. 命令语法:Windows使用的是基于DOS的命令行,命令和参数之间使用空格分隔。而Linux使用的是基于UNIX的命令行,命令和参数之间使用空格或者等号分隔。

    2. 路径表示:在Windows中,文件路径使用反斜杠(\)作为分隔符,例如C:\Windows\System32。而在Linux中,文件路径使用正斜杠(/)作为分隔符,例如/usr/local/bin。

    3. 命令名称和参数:Windows中的命令通常是单词的缩写,例如dir(显示目录内容)或者ipconfig(显示网络配置信息)。而Linux中的命令通常是单词的全称,例如ls(显示目录内容)或者ifconfig(显示网络配置信息)。

    4. 文件管理:在Windows中,文件夹被称为目录,文件路径是以驱动器字母开头,例如C:\。在Linux中,文件夹被称为目录,文件路径是以根目录(/)开头。

    5. 文件扩展名:Windows中的文件通常有扩展名(例如.txt或.exe),而Linux中的文件通常没有扩展名。Linux通过文件权限和文件类型来确定如何处理文件。

    总的来说,Windows和Linux在命令行操作方面有一些区别,包括命令语法、路径表示、命令名称和参数、文件管理以及文件扩展名。对于使用这两个操作系统的人来说,了解这些区别可以更好地进行命令行操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Windows和Linux是两种不同的操作系统,它们的命令行界面和命令有一些区别。下面是Windows和Linux命令的一些主要区别:

    1. 命令行界面:
    Windows使用命令提示符(Command Prompt)或PowerShell作为命令行界面,而Linux使用终端(Terminal)。Windows的命令提示符较为简单,而PowerShell较为强大,支持更多的功能和命令。Linux的终端一般是基于Bash(Bourne Again SHell)的,也可以使用其他的终端。

    2. 命令格式:
    在Windows命令行中,命令和参数之间使用空格分隔,而在Linux中,命令和参数之间通常使用空格或者制表符分隔。

    3. 文件路径:
    在Windows中,文件路径使用反斜杠(\)作为路径分隔符,例如C:\Windows\System32。而在Linux中,文件路径使用正斜杠(/)作为路径分隔符,例如/home/user/document。

    4. 命令名称:
    Windows和Linux中的一些常用命令名称是不同的。例如,Windows中的复制命令是”copy”,而Linux中是”cp”;Windows中的删除命令是”del”,而Linux中是”rm”。

    5. 命令选项:
    在Windows中,命令选项使用斜杠(/)作为前缀,例如”/a”代表所有文件,而在Linux中,命令选项使用破折号(-)作为前缀,例如”-a”代表所有文件。

    6. 文件和目录权限:
    Windows使用访问控制列表(Access Control List)来管理文件和目录的权限,而Linux使用权限位(Permission Bits)和用户组(User Group)来管理文件和目录的权限。

    7. 命令的输出和重定向:
    Windows和Linux中都支持将命令的输出重定向到文件。然而,Windows使用大于号(>)进行重定向,例如”dir > output.txt”,而Linux使用大于号(>)和双大于号(>>)进行重定向,例如”ls > output.txt”和”ls >> output.txt”。

    总结起来,Windows和Linux命令在语法和使用上有一些区别,熟悉了这些区别之后,可以在不同的操作系统中更加灵活地使用命令行界面。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部